How To Fix /SAPAPO/ORDER_SPLIT031 - Error occured while reading the data


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SAPAPO/ORDER_SPLIT -

  • Message number: 031

  • Message text: Error occured while reading the data

    The SAP error message /SAPAPO/ORDER_SPLIT031 typically indicates that there was an issue while reading data related to order splitting in the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) module. This error can occur due to various reasons, including data inconsistencies, missing data, or configuration issues.

    Possible Causes:

    1.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the master data or transaction data that the system is trying to read.
    2. Missing Data: Required data for the order or related objects may be missing or not properly maintained.
    3. Configuration Issues: Incorrect configuration settings in the APO system can lead to errors when processing orders.
    4.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the data being read.
    5. Technical Issues: There could be underlying technical issues, such as database problems or system performance issues.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Master Data: Verify that all relevant master data (e.g., materials, resources, and production versions) is correctly maintained and consistent.
    2. Review Transaction Data: Ensure that the transaction data related to the orders is complete and accurate.
    3. Configuration Review: Check the configuration settings in the APO system to ensure they are set up correctly for order splitting.
    4. Authorization Check: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the data. This can be done by checking the user roles and authorizations in the SAP system.
    5. Debugging: If you have access to debugging tools, you can analyze the program or function module that is generating the error to identify the root cause.
    6. Consult Logs: Check the application logs (transaction SLG1) for more detailed error messages that can provide additional context.
    7. SAP Notes: Search for relevant SAP Notes in the SAP Support Portal that may address this specific error or provide patches or updates.
    8. Contact SAP Support: If the issue persists and cannot be resolved internally, consider reaching out to SAP Support for assistance.
